`
lianxiangbus
  • 浏览: 534835 次
文章分类
社区版块
存档分类
最新评论

Encode String&&湘潭大学月赛

 
阅读更多
题目描述
字符串压缩有一种简单的方法,就是直接统计连续出现的字符的个数,然后用一个数字+一个字符代替,比如aaa会被代替为3a,bbbb会被代替为4b。

现在我给你一个串,求它用这个方法压缩过后的串。

输入
包含多组数据。第一行是一个整数N,表示样例的个数。以后每行为一个样例,为一个仅仅包含小写字母的字符串,长度不超过1000;

输出
每组数据输出一行,为压缩过后的串。

样例输入
2

aaabbbb

ddreeeeeeeeee

样例输出
3a4b

2d1r10e

AC代码:



分享到:
评论

相关推荐

    EncodeDecode & ANSI-UTF8编码转换工具

    "EncodeDecode & ANSI-UTF8编码转换工具"是一款专门用于解决这个问题的软件,它能够帮助用户将文本数据从ANSI编码转换为UTF-8编码,反之亦然。这两种编码方式在不同的上下文中有各自的适用性,理解它们的差异和用途...

    MTASA-encodeString-bug:encodeString和encodeString在奇数字节大小的情况下工作不正确

    《MTASA(Multi Theft Auto: San Andreas)中的Lua编码字符串问题——encodeString函数解析与修复策略》 在Multi Theft Auto: San Andreas (MTASA) 的扩展脚本环境中,Lua语言被广泛使用,以实现游戏的各种自定义...

    delphi2010 base64_encode&decode

    标题"delphi2010 base64_encode&decode"指的是使用Delphi 2010编程环境实现的Base64编码和解码功能。Delphi是一款强大的面向对象的集成开发环境(IDE),主要用于编写Windows应用程序,其语法基于Pascal语言。 描述...

    itext 支持中文 PDF417

    String FilePath "d: images "+codeValue+" jpg"; 注释部分可以以文件方式保存 File f new File FilePath ; ImageIO write img "jpg" response getOutputStream ;">iText 5 0 2 ...

    《QRCode生成二维码(支持中文)源码》

    修改库QRCodeLib中的类QRCodeEncoder.cs 将public virtual Bitmap Encode(String content)里面的 return Encode(content, Encoding.Unicode); 修改为 return Encode(content, Encoding.GetEncoding("gb2312")); 这样...

    字符串的encode/escape

    String encodedUrl = URLEncoder.encode(str, StandardCharsets.UTF_8); System.out.println("Encoded URL: " + encodedUrl); // HTML 转义 String escapedHtml = StringEscapeUtils.escapeHtml4(str); System...

    PY-ENCODE:轻松加密所有Python脚本

    截屏安装 : apt update apt install git python2 -y git clone https://github.com/PY-ENCODE cd PY-ENCODE运行: python2 PY-ENCODE.py或者 ; 使用单个命令apt update && apt install git python2 -y && git clone...

    字符串转EnCode_c#

    字符串转EnCode_c# 字符串转EnCode_c# 字符串转EnCode_c# 字符串转EnCode_c# 字符串转EnCode_c# 字符串转EnCode_c# 字符串转EnCode_c# 字符串转EnCode_c#

    md5加密解密 string Md5Encode::Encode

    std::(std::string src_info) { ParamDynamic param; param.ua_ = kA; param.ub_ = kB; param.uc_ = kC; param.ud_ = kD; std::string result; const char *src_data = src_info.c_str(); char *out_data_...

    zxing.jar.

    public static void encode String url String path String format int width int height { try { BitMatrix bitmatrix new MultiFormatWriter encode new String url getBytes "GBK" "ISO ...

    Unicode encode & decode tools

    一个简单的HTML页面,实现中文Unicode的转换。 本来自己随便写的,方便开发使用,希望给有需要的人一点帮助。

    delphi 2010升级到xe8后,decodestring汉字出现:No mapping for the.mht

    delphi 2010升级到xe8后,decodestring汉字出现:No mapping for the.mht

    helix-mp3 encode & decode source code

    《helix-mp3编码与解码源代码详解》 MP3编码与解码是音频处理领域中的核心技术,尤其在数字音频娱乐系统中扮演着重要角色。本文将深入探讨由helix社区开发的MP3编码与解码源代码,帮助读者理解其内部机制和工作原理...

    turbo encode&decode,turbo码编译码程序

    Turbo 码编译码程序c++版,支持自定义信噪比、两种码率(1/2、1/3)、Log-MAP和MAX-LOG-MAP译码、自选译码迭代次数、AWGN和Rayleigh信道模拟。代码结构清晰,方便学习

    decode & encode PNG files

    本文将围绕“decode & encode PNG files”这一主题,详细讲解PNG文件的解码与编码过程,以及相关资源的使用。 首先,让我们了解一下PNG文件的基本结构。PNG文件采用了一种称为LZ77的无损数据压缩算法,同时包含了一...

    VB Script EnCode 解密程序

    VB Script EnCode是一种在VBScript(Visual Basic Script)编程环境中使用的加密技术,它允许程序员对源代码进行编码,以防止未经授权的用户查看或修改代码。VBScript是Microsoft开发的一种脚本语言,常用于Web页面...

    HtmlEncode编码与解码用法定义

    htmlencode、htmldecode,html编码,可以方便在web页面,显示html源码,一般将<>&单引号,双引号进行转码。这也是防止html注入攻击一个好方法!

    encode加密解密.rar

    《深入理解encode加密解密技术》 在信息技术领域,数据安全是至关重要的议题,而加密技术则是保护数据安全的重要手段。本文将详细探讨encode加密解密的概念、原理以及实际应用,旨在帮助读者全面理解这一技术。 一...

    短信猫字符集转化的功能函数

    std::string encode7Bit(const std::string& input); std::string decode7Bit(const std::string& input); // UCS2编码函数 std::wstring encodeUCS2(const std::string& input); std::string decodeUCS2(const std...

    jpeg-encode.zip_jpeg_jpeg encode_jpeg encode linux_linux视频监控_视频监

    标题中的“jpeg-encode.zip_jpeg_jpeg encode_jpeg encode linux_linux视频监控_视频监”表明这个压缩包可能包含了一组用于在Linux环境下进行JPEG编码的工具或代码库,特别适用于资源有限的嵌入式系统,例如视频监控...

Global site tag (gtag.js) - Google Analytics